So I only go as an absolute last resort. I got my first migraine at 12, in 2002. And I’ve been to the ER maybe 6 times since then. It’s rarely a pleasant experience.

Usually if it’s M-F during office hours, I’ll call my primary care Dr and tell them I’m coming in for a migraine, no appointment needed, just walk in style (def not the norm for most people). I have had the same primary Dr since I was a child so there is no messing around. I walk in and get a “hi OP, room 1”, they walk back and shut the light off and Dr comes in gives me a small hug and the nurse gives me shots. 1 shot in each side of my butt, go home and sleep the rest if the day. This I have had to do countless times, couldn’t even begin to put a number on it over the years.
